Runbook: LedgerInk PDF Invoice Renderer

The renderer runs in an isolated worker pool with no outbound network access; fonts and templates are baked into the image at build time. All input documents are schema-validated before rasterization, and any embedded JavaScript in source PDFs is stripped. Rotation of the signing material happens during the monthly maintenance window. For your review, the effective production configuration as of this revision is reproduced below.

deployment values, kajep-kageg:
[praix]
host = praix.paliqcorp.corp
user = praix_svc
database = praix_prod

## Quillpress Renderer — Environments

Quillpress converts user markdown into sanitized HTML for the Fennelwood docs portal. Each environment runs its own rendering pool with different sanitization strictness and timeout limits. Support should check which environment a rendering complaint comes from before escalating, since behavior differs. The production pipeline currently runs with the following configuration values.

settings of fafog-haduf:
ZORIX_PIN=4648
ZORIX_METRICS_HOST=metrics.zorix.paliqsys.corp
ZORIX_LOG_LEVEL=info
ZORIX_TENANT=druix

Handover Note — Insurance Renewal

Branch managers: renewal with Halverth Mutual closes end of month. Premium up 8%; property cover unchanged, liability cap raised per last year's Orlenne claim. Each branch must confirm asset registers before binding. Outstanding: Westmoor branch valuation and the fleet schedule. Dana handled negotiations; I'm taking over sign-off. Context for the renewal decision is in the confidential note below.

confidential, kagep-kahof: Druokax Systems plans to lower the Ulaath list price by 53 percent in March.